site stats

Logic programming languages

WitrynaLogic Basic is a programming language to facilitate the development of programs, and is therefore an ideal tool to develop the programming logic in children, youth and … Witryna27 lip 2024 · Prolog was created in1960. Its abbreviation is “Programming in Logic.” The language is a little different than other AI and ML programming languages. It is a logical language that is not like the classical languages for AI. Automatic backtracking is a basic tool of Prolog. So is pattern matching. When choosing to learn AI …

Prolog - Introduction - TutorialsPoint

WitrynaIn computer programming language: Declarative languages. Logic programming languages, of which PROLOG ( pro gramming in log ic) is the best known, state a … WitrynaLogic programming is a programming paradigm which is largely based on formal logic. Any program written in a logic programming language is a set of sentences in logical form, expressing facts and rules about some problem domain. Major logic programming language families include Prolog, answer set programming (ASP) … red dead redemption 2 boring https://dickhoge.com

PPL Complete notes - LECTURE NOTES ON PRINCIPLES OF PROGRAMMING …

WitrynaLogic programming is a programming paradigm which is largely based on formal logic. Any program written in a logic programming language is a set of sentences … WitrynaComputer Science: Programming with a Purpose. Skills you'll gain: Computer Programming, Java Programming, Algorithms, Theoretical Computer Science, C Programming Language Family, Data Visualization, Plot (Graphics), Python Programming, Computational Logic, Computer Science, Data Management, Data … Witryna13 kwi 2024 · SFC is a standard language defined by IEC 61131-3, which is a set of specifications for programmable logic controllers (PLCs). This language allows you … red dead redemption 2 bonus bank robbery

Prolog - Introduction - TutorialsPoint

Category:Difference Between Functional and Logical Programming

Tags:Logic programming languages

Logic programming languages

Logic programming - Harvard University

Witryna19 lis 2024 · Haskell. Haskell is polymorphically statically typed and it is built on the lambda calculus. This is a programming language that is named after a mathematician called Haskell B Curry. It is hard to learn and explore as it follows a 100% functional paradigm and involves intense use of jargon which might seem hard for beginners.

Logic programming languages

Did you know?

Witryna7 kwi 2024 · Programming logic is the foundation of any successful coding project. It involves the ability to think logically and solve complex problems through coding. Here are some tips to help develop strong programming logic skills: Use Simple Language. One of the most important aspects of programming logic is the ability to … WitrynaIn computer science, declarative programming is a programming paradigm—a style of building the structure and elements of computer programs—that expresses the logic of a computation without describing its control flow.. Many languages that apply this style attempt to minimize or eliminate side effects by describing what the program must …

Witryna10 kwi 2024 · Scallop: A Language for Neurosymbolic Programming. We present Scallop, a language which combines the benefits of deep learning and logical … WitrynaLogic programming languages. This category lists programming languages that support the logical programming paradigm.

WitrynaLogic programming is a programming paradigm which is largely based on formal logic.Any program written in a logic programming language is a set of sentences in logical form, expressing facts and rules about some problem domain. Major logic programming language families include Prolog, answer set programming (ASP) … Witryna3 sty 2024 · Programming languages are the formal language, with a set of instructions which provides the desired output. ... Logic-based Programming Languages: Logic programming is a type of programming paradigm which is largely based on formal logic. logic -based programming are set of sentences in logical form, which …

Witryna2 maj 2024 · Programming languages aren't always tied to a specific paradigm. There are languages that have been built with a certain paradigm in mind and have features …

Witryna28 cze 2024 · Prolog is a logic programming language. It has important role in artificial intelligence. Unlike many other programming languages, Prolog is intended … red dead redemption 2 boring redditWitryna10 kwi 2024 · Scallop: A Language for Neurosymbolic Programming. We present Scallop, a language which combines the benefits of deep learning and logical reasoning. Scallop enables users to write a wide range of neurosymbolic applications and train them in a data- and compute-efficient manner. It achieves these goals through … red dead redemption 2 bolt action rifleVarious implementations have been developed from Prolog to extend logic programming capabilities in numerous directions. These include types, modes, constraint logic programming (CLP), object-oriented logic programming (OOLP), concurrency, linear logic (LLP), functional and higher-order logic programming capabilities, plus interoperability with knowledge bases: Prolog is an untyped language. Attempts to introduce types date back to the 1980s, and as of 2… red dead redemption 2 braithwaite manor goldWitryna11 kwi 2024 · Explore each language's importance, common applications, and how to learn them. We have organized the following list of the top 12 coding languages for … knitted chickens for eggsWitryna18 mar 2024 · Scripting Programming Languages; Markup Programming Languages; Logic-Based Programming Languages; Concurrent Programming Languages; … red dead redemption 2 braithwaite gold barWitryna21 mar 2024 · This means a program is defined by a set of facts and rules that a machine uses to solve a problem. Some examples of logic programming languages … knitted chicken sweatersWitryna8 mar 2024 · Algebraic Logic Functional Programming. There are several types of programming languages used for different purposes. Two well-known types of programming languages are functional and logic. Algebraic Logic Functional (ALF) is a programming language that combines these two types, functional and logic … red dead redemption 2 bonus content